Abstract
The current research involved the investigation of the prevalence and laboratory patterns of Aeromonas hydrophila in human clinical samples. Two hundred clinical samples were examined of which 20 samples (10%) were positive to the A. hydrophila and 180 samples (90) were negative. The highest isolation rate was detected in stool samples of 15 positive isolates (15%), which showed gastrointestinal infections to have a strong association. The rates of lower isolation were found in urine samples (7%), and blood samples (6.7%). Wound/burn samples did not recover any isolates which implies that this pathogen does not play a major role in this type of infection among the population under study.
The first classification was carried out on morphological basis. On both MacConkey agar and blood agar, all isolates grew well as non-lactose-fermenting colonies and gave smooth and hemolytic colonies respectively. The capability of growing in enriched media was indicated by the growth on chocolate agar. The microscopic observation revealed all the isolates to be Gram-negative bacteria.
Anoxidase- and catalase-tests showed that all the isolates were positive, as expected of A. hydrophila. The system was identified by VITEK 2 Compact system with 100 percent consensus with the conventional methods. PCR showed the presence of the lipase gene in 90% and the protease gene in 100% of isolates, indicating the genetic presence of virulence-associated determinants. In general, the research confirms the clinical value of A. hydrophila, especially in gastrointestinal infections, and the importance of a combination of the conventional, automated, and molecular diagnostic methods.
